"Poseidon's Heir"

Gravill's life has always been shrouded in mystery and solitude, raised by his mother in a world of secrecy and half-truths. But when the truth about his father's identity finally surfaces, Gravill's world is turned upside down. He is the son of Poseidon, the powerful god of the sea, making him a demigod - an existence forbidden by the laws of Olympus.

As Gravill navigates this new reality, he finds himself thrust into a world of danger and uncertainty. His half-blood status makes him a target for those who seek to exploit his divine heritage, and he must confront the darkness that has haunted his family for generations.

With his newfound identity comes a journey of self-discovery and growth, as Gravill must come to terms with his powers, his destiny, and the weight of his father's legacy. Along the way, he will encounter a cast of characters who will aid or hinder his progress, from enigmatic allies to formidable foes.

As he embarks on this perilous path, he will uncover secrets about the gods' true intentions, and the prophecy that binds him to the fate of Olympus. Will he find a way to claim his rightful place among the gods, or will the shadows of his past consume him? "Poseidon's Heir" is a tale of adventure, magic, and the unbreakable bonds of family and identity.
